What are Link Insertions?
A planned link-building practice in which you acquire backlinks within existing, relevant content on other websites can be referred as link insertions or niche edits. Do not confuse it with guest posting which requires creating new content for another website in return for a backlink. In link insertions, you integrate your link effortlessly into an already published piece. This technique has many benefits which will be explored later in this blog.
Here's how this process usually works:
Identify Relevant Websites:
First and foremost is to identify high-quality websites which have established content aligning with your niche and target audience. There are several SEO tools and techniques to help you find these websites.
Reach Out to Website Owners:
Send customized email pitches that provide value to website owners, discussing the advantages of adding your link to their content.
Negotiate Placement and Anchor Text:
Have a proper discussion on potential fees or link placement within the content and decide on convincing anchor text that merges organically with the existing content.
- Monitor and Maintain Links: Analyze your acquired backlinks and make sure to monitor them in case there’s a need for any potential link removal.

Link Insertions vs. Guest Posting: A Comparative Analysis
Link insertions as well as guest posting both are effective link-building strategies, but with their own benefits and drawbacks. Here's a breakdown for you to help you make a decision which approach is more apt for your needs:
Feature | Link Insertions | Guest Posting |
Resource Investment | Lower (focus on outreach and negotiation) | Higher (requires content creation) |
Content Creation Burden | None (utilizes existing content) | High (need to create high-quality content) |
Link Placement Control | Higher (can negotiate specific placement) | Lower (limited control over placement within guest post) |
Turnaround Time | Potentially faster (no content creation needed) | Slower (content creation and publication process) |
Guest posting helps you to show your know-how through comprehensive content creation, while link insertions provide quicker implementation and more targeted link placement. When deciding between these two, consider your content creation resources, turnaround time expectations, and desired level of control over link placement.

Advantages and Disadvantages of Link Insertions
Advantages:
- It is a more cost-effective technique to get backlinks than guest posting.
- It offers more control over link placement.
- Since no new content has to be created, it is generally quicker.
- It is more scalable as a large number of appropriate websites can be targeted for link insertion.
Disadvantages:
- You are dependent on approval of the website owner for your campaign’s success.
- You do not have any say in the quality of content and content strategy of website for link insertion.
- It is possible that the website owner will remove your link in the future.
